i'm withdrawing $100,000 from my 401k i'm 60 yrs old how much will that effect my 2020 tax return

Since you are over 591/2, there is no 10% penalty on your withdrawal from your 401K.   The 401(k) plan provider will be required to withhold 20% for federal income taxes and 2% to 8% for state income taxes, depending upon state of residence. 401(k) withdrawals are taxed like ordinary income.
